Time taken to damage a vehicle without a catalytic converter

Driving without a catalytic converter can cause damage to the engine due to an imbalance in the air-to-fuel ratio. The engine may experience reduced performance, decreased fuel efficiency, and potentially fail altogether. Additionally, the increased emissions could damage the oxygen sensors and exhaust system, leading to costly repairs in the long term.

It is difficult to put a specific timeframe on the damage that driving without a catalytic converter will cause, as it will depend on the individual vehicle and driving conditions. However, it is not recommended to drive without a catalytic converter for any length of time as it can wreak havoc on the vehicle and greatly impact its lifespan.

Implications of driving without a catalytic converter

Driving without a catalytic converter has a significant impact on air quality due to increased emissions. The resulting pollution negatively affects the environment and can cause respiratory issues in humans and animals. In some areas, driving without a catalytic converter is illegal, and failure to comply can result in fines and even legal action.

Replacing a catalytic converter

If a catalytic converter needs to be replaced, it is recommended to seek out a trusted mechanic who specializes in such repairs. The cost of a replacement can vary depending on the make and model of the vehicle, with some prices ranging from hundreds to thousands of dollars.

When choosing a replacement catalytic converter, it is important to ensure that it meets the appropriate specifications for the vehicle make and model. It is recommended to purchase from a reputable manufacturer or dealership to avoid purchasing a substandard or counterfeit part.

Warning signs of catalytic converter failure

It is important to be aware of the warning signs of catalytic converter failure, so that the part can be replaced before the engine sustains permanent damage. Some symptoms of a failing catalytic converter include a decrease in engine performance, strange odors or noises, and a decrease in fuel efficiency. If any of these symptoms are present, it is recommended to take the vehicle in for a diagnostic test immediately.
